Guest guest Posted July 6, 2001 Report Share Posted July 6, 2001 Dear Kumar, Cancelled in this case actually means mended, by various neecha bhanga.. There are clear evidences in classical texts that when graha is neech in rashi and uchch in navamsa it gives good results, while vice-versa is bad.. That is why debilitation in navamsa is hard to improve..Neecha graha always remains with a neecha dosha, however, when neecha bhanga occurs it gives beneficial results as well. Guest guest Posted July 8, 2001 Report Share Posted July 8, 2001 Dear Kumar, The highest neecha point is very bad. It will certainly severely damage graha on the level of its karakatwa, adhipatya and position. However, neecha bhanga yoga would give on the other hand beneficial results, irrespective of graha being in its highest neecha or not. If neecha bhanga occurs at yogkarak it will surely give raj yog effects. Neecha dosha usually gets manifested at sociaological and physiological levels of significations..
